Output 592feeeb24668c4c721d53221040faed27c9864adb518106af4af7a2b1f56dbd:0

value
601170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50d8406be2f69d869e110a1ec727351d2228560 OP_EQUAL
address
3M7Y3VYGZ9TC1Ebb8gzUY3YYkyTXK4s1kZ
transaction
592feeeb24668c4c721d53221040faed27c9864adb518106af4af7a2b1f56dbd
spent
true